PLASMA: SMOOTH MOVING PICTURES WITH 100 HZ DOUBLE SCAN
The standard European PAL broadcast signal is 50Hz – meaning that the
on-screen image on your TV is refreshed 50 times each second. However,
VIERA plasma TVs have 100Hz Double Scan technology built in, meaning that
the screen refresh rate is doubled, resulting in flicker-less and beautifully
smooth moving images.
PLASMA: EXCELLENT MOTION-IMAGE RESOLUTION WITH INTELLIGENT FRAME CREATION
In order to deliver you the smoothest possible on-screen motion, our
high-end VIERA plasma TVs come equipped with Intelligent Frame
Creation technology. Using the formidable computing power of V-Real PRO 3
processor, motion compensated additional frames are created and inserted
between the source frames resulting in ultra-smooth on-screen movement.
Furthermore, when it comes to original movie material that is shot in 24p
format, 24p Real Cinema technology kicks-in and reduces judder ensuring
that original content is super smooth!
VIERA TVs feature Panasonic’s image-enhancing system V-real PRO 3,
which applies full-digital processing to the 1920 x 1080 high-definition
video signals received from HD broadcasts and Blu-ray discs. Because
the signals are processed digitally from initial input all the way to final
display, there is virtually no loss of image quality. Pictures are exquisitely
clear and remarkably detailed, with even delicate textures and patterns
visible. With its 1920 x 1080p resolution, the VIERA full HD panel displays
beautiful images without needing to perform pixel conversion for the
1080p video signals pro cessed by the video circuitry. Panasonic
offers the full HD panel in 32-inch and larger models.

PLASMA: HIGH SPEED PERFORMANCE WITH 0.001 MILLISECONDS RESPONSE TIME
VIERA Plasma TVs are using self-illuminating cells instead of liquid crystal
displays enabling them to achieve an ultra-fast response time of 0.001
milli seconds which makes them especially good when it comes to fast
moving images like those seen in sporting events or gaming.
